Work Permits
How to get a work permit?
1. The first step is to find a job.
2, Complete a work permit application (this form is entitled: STATEMENT OF INTENT TO EMPLOY A MINOR AND REQUEST FOR A WORK PERMIT – CDE Form B1-1). This form is available for you to download below. It must be signed by the student, a parent and the employer.
3. Submit the application to the Counseling office for verification.
4. Your application will be reviewed by your Counselor, after that you will need to bring in the completed STATEMENT OF INTENT TO EMPLOY A MINOR AND REQUEST FOR A WORK PERMIT – CDE Form B1-1 to the College & Career Center in i-121 with ORIGINAL signatures ONLY in order for it to be processed!
5. Pick up Work Permit before the end of day by 3:30 pm or the following day starting at 8:30 am. You will need a current photo I.D. for your work permit to be issued.
Entertainment Work Permits (EWP)
If you are a minor seeking a work permit in the entertainment business, minors may download the Entertainment Work Permit Application HERE. The EWP must be signed and stamped by the minor's School of Attendance. The document may be emailed to the minor's school administrator or designee for verification of Satisfactory Grades and Attendance. The LAUSD WEE Office CANNOT sign on the school's behalf.
It is the parent/guardian's responsibility to contact the Entertainment Work Permit office to obtain the legal work permit. Additional information about obtaining an Entertainment Work Permit may be found by visiting the EWP Website: https://www.dir.ca.gov/dlse/entertainment-work-permit.htm

During school vacations Work Permits can be processed at the Work Experience Education office at Beaudry on the 25th floor. There will be signs leading to their office in the building. Their office hours are from 8:00 am to 4:30 pm Monday through Friday; there is no need for an appointment.
